Neck Lift
What is a Neck Lift?
A Neck Lift is a specialized surgical procedure designed to restore a youthful, defined neck contour by addressing sagging skin, excess fat, and muscle laxity. Over time, aging, genetics, and weight fluctuations can lead to the appearance of jowls, a double chin, or vertical neck bands. Unlike non-surgical treatments that offer temporary improvements, a Neck Lift provides long-lasting, natural-looking results by tightening and repositioning the deeper structures of the neck.
How is the Procedure Performed?
A Neck Lift is typically performed under general anesthesia or local anesthesia with sedation. The procedure involves the following steps:
- Incision Placement: Small incisions are made behind the ears and under the chin to ensure minimal visibility.
- Muscle Tightening: The platysma muscle, which contributes to neck banding, is tightened and repositioned.
- Fat Removal or Redistribution: Excess fat is removed via liposuction or repositioned for a smoother contour.
- Skin Re-Draping: Loose skin is carefully trimmed and redraped to eliminate sagging while maintaining a natural appearance.
- Closure: Incisions are meticulously closed to minimize scarring, ensuring a refined and youthful result.
Who is a Good Candidate?
A Neck Lift is ideal for individuals who:
- Have loose, sagging skin on the neck.
- Experience visible muscle bands or a "turkey neck" appearance.
- Have excess fat accumulation under the chin.
- Desire a more defined jawline and smoother neck contour.
- Are in good overall health and have realistic expectations.
Recovery & Results
- Swelling & Bruising: Most patients experience swelling and mild bruising for 7-14 days.
- Return to Work: Light activities can be resumed in 7-10 days, while strenuous exercises should be avoided for 4-6 weeks.
- Final Results: Visible improvement appears within 4-6 weeks, with full results settling over 3-6 months.
- Longevity: Results typically last 10-15 years, depending on lifestyle and skincare habits.
Risks & Considerations
While a Neck Lift is a safe procedure when performed by an experienced surgeon, potential risks include:
- Temporary numbness or tightness.
- Minor swelling or bruising.
- Scarring, which fades over time and is well-hidden.
- Rare complications such as hematoma or infection.
